As soon as they are here daily with baby sightings and updates, I may switch to the eagle trees for my daily weather pic, if it's not too much of a distraction. They do usually show a lot of sky

We're just happy to see them back. Once the baby left the nest in late summer, the parents left also.... They've been stopping back by the nest periodically over winter, but most of the time they've been away wherever they go... at the ocean or following fish runs, I wish I knew! We miss them when they're gone. Once they start breeding and laying eggs, one of them will be at the nest pretty much all the time from then on until eaglet(s) start to fly.
